On September 2, 2013, at the age of 64, Diana Nyad emerged onto the shores of Key West after completing a 110 mile, 53 hour, record-breaking swim through shark-infested waters from Cuba to Florida. Her memoir shows why, at 64 she was able to achieve what she couldn't at 30 and how her repeated failures contributed to her success.

Set in the early 20th century, this feel-good underdog story of the first American swimmer to win Olympic gold follows Charles Daniels, who, to overcome his family’s disgrace and his mental health struggles, took to the water in an era when competitive sports were still in their infancy.
